Learn more about Sag Harbor
Centuries-old captains' homes line the streets of this former whaling port, where maritime history feels as fresh as the sea breeze. The Sag Harbor Whaling and Historical Museum tells tales of seafaring glory while the first U.S. custom house on Long Island stands as testament to the village's importance. Kayak through Peconic Bay's protected waters before catching an evening performance at Bay Street Theater. The historic business district offers boutique shopping that puts mall experiences to shame. Havens Beach provides a perfect sunset spot without the crowds of other Hamptons beaches. For the full experience, time a visit to coincide with HarborFest when locals celebrate their nautical heritage with whale boat races and clam chowder contests.
